Speaker: Nandini Trivedi / Ohio State University

Remarkably, across the superconductor-insulator transition driven by disorder and magnetic field, both the BCS and Anderson localization paradigms are broken. I will discuss the behavior of the gap, the superfluid density, and the dynamical conductivity across the transition. I will also compare our theoretical results obtained with a combination of self-consistent Bogoliubov de-Gennes and quantum Monte Carlo techniques with experiments and highlight the open questions in the field.
